Mike was back in school the following week, surprisingly normal and friendly considering how shut off he'd been the week before. He'd handed in the missed work all completed, albeit with a few slight noticeable switches in handwriting styles here and there. He avoided people whom he'd been told had given him a hard time last week, but overall things were going well for now.
Zoey was waiting for the right time to approach him about the note, but it didn't come until school was already let out.
She still had more obstacles to get through beforehand, however.
She felt a grimy hand grab her arm as she finished descending a stairwell and pull her forcibly to the area under said stairs, almost causing her to trip. Catching her breath in her throat, she blinked and saw Scott looking straight at her with wide eyes. "Wh-what the heck, Scott, you can't just grab someone out of nowhere like that-!" she started to protest.
"Shut it! This'll be quick, I promise," he replied in his usually snivelly voice with some urgency mixed in. "You're close with the new class freak show, right?" One of his hands had a notable new reddened line crossing over the knuckles, stark against his pale skin and contrasting other, more faded lines on his fingers. "Mike or Sva-something or whatever it is, I can't keep track."
Zoey frowned. "He's not a freak show. And we're not close, I just have classes with him." She wanted to be better friends with Mike. Scott didn't need to know that.
"Eh, you're the only person I seen 'em with outside class stuff. And," Scott admitted, "you saw what that sicko did to me." He removed his hand from her arm and held it up for emphasis.
"Tch…I didn't see anything. You probably instigated something like you always do," Zoey retorted, recalling oh so many instances of seeing him carted off to the principal for causing problems, calling her and other people rude or inappropriate things, and yanked away from the school by his red-faced mother in her frumpy old dresses she'd always worn while she yelled at him in a hefty accent.
Scott smirked. "That's besides the point, neighbor. I'm doing you a favor here by telling you to steer clear." He didn't deny what she'd said at all. "Wouldn't want your little pretty face getting messed up." He moved his hand to graze her cheek but she slapped it away.
"Whatever you're trying to say, I'm not buying it, and I need to get home," she said finally, turning to leave the stairwell.
I know he wouldn't hurt me. He's proven that before…at least, Mike has. When he's himself.
Scott frowned deeply, starting to follow her. "I'm not sayin' this stuff for nothin', Zoey. He's got a devil inside him, as my Pappy, may he rest in dirt, would've said. Me and you known each other forever, I trust you to know this too." He pulled up the strap of his oversized, slightly hole-spotted tank top to keep it from falling down his shoulder. "We're friends enough, right?"
Zoey looked over her shoulder and glared at him. "You and I are not friends. I barely know anything about you, other than you've been nothing but unpleasant since we were kids." She kept walking towards the exit of the school, hoping to lose him in the shuffle of other students heading out for the day.
"At least you know I'm me, always will be! And not some crazed lunatic pretending to be a foreigner girl!" Scott called to her after he stopped pursuing. "Don't trust that demon!"
Zoey looped around to her locker and took several breaths to calm herself. He's not like that. He's not a bad guy.
She chose to believe what little she understood, rather than consider asking further about what happened that day in that dark classroom. She barely knew a thing about Mike either; unlike with Scott, though, that only made her want to learn more.
It was at this point that she spotted him down the hall, shuffling through his own locker. He looked a bit distracted, staring down at a folder in his hand for a minute straight before blinking and putting it in his bag.
She had kept the note in her pocket and pulled it out as she approached him. "Hey, Mike?" she phrased her greeting as a question, double checking it was him.
Mike was slow to process the words being said to him but looked down from his much taller height. "Hm?" His eyes were half-closed and blinking periodically. "Hello," he replied quietly.
"Uh…I got your note," Zoey said awkwardly, unsure what was up with him at this moment. It was him, for sure.
Mike was silent in this state for a couple minutes before he came back around. Embarrassed, he looked away. "Sorry, can we…start that again?" he asked, rubbing his eyes. "I lost track of things for a second."
Zoey raised an eyebrow but nodded. "I said I got your note the other day…I would like to catch up some time, if you still wanted to do that," she explained. "It's…been hard to find a good time to talk, huh?"
"Yeah, seriously," Mike agreed, looking more with it now that…whatever had just happened was over. "I would like that too. I don't remember a lot from before I moved away from here, but I did remember you." He smiled lightly.
Zoey's face suddenly felt warmer upon hearing that. "S-so are you doing anything after school because we could talk right now-" she asked nervously.
"Sure, we can talk now," he replied calmly. "I have to wait for my ride home for another hour, anyway."
So he didn't drive. "Oh. Um, I have my own car, we could…if it's alright with you I could maybe drive…somewhere?" Zoey suggested. What is up with you, you never do this around guys. Get a grip.
She shouldn't have been so surprised when he said yes.
